County to destroy special education records for some

Published 12:00 am Saturday, June 18, 2016

The Covington County Board of Education is scheduled to destroy special education records on Aug. 2, 2016.

Records set to be destroyed are those of students born in 1990.

If you are the parent of a child or a former student age 26, in Covington County Schools, born in 1990, you may pick up records at the Covington County Board of Education from 8 a.m. until 3 p.m., Monday through Thursday, July 18, 2016 through July 28, 2016.

If you are unable to pick up your records, you may request them by sending a written authorization to release the records to:

Mrs. Kelley McCollough, special education coordinator, Covington County Schools, 807 CC Baker Avenue, Andalusia, AL 36420.

Your letter should include your current mailing address and phone number.
